Orange Juice rose to 258.02 USd/Lbs on September 1, 2025, up 11.07% from the previous day. Over the past month, Orange Juice's price has risen 10.13%, but it is still 50.19% lower than a year ago, according to trading on a contract for difference (CFD) that tracks the benchmark market for this commodity. In the 52 weeks ended on April 20, 2025, Tropicana was the leading refrigerated orange juice brand in the United States, based on sales of one billion U.S. dollars. Other brands leading the rankings included Simply Orange and Florida's Natural. Juice and juice drink smoothie brands Some of the favorite refrigerated juice and juice drink smoothie brands in the United States in 2019 included Naked Juice, Bolthouse Farms, and Odwalla. Based on sales exceeding 500 million U.S. dollars, Naked Juice was by far the leading brand of the year. Consumption of juice in the US In 2025, people in the United States had consumed fewer gallons of juice, when compared to the average of 2021. Between those years, the average annual consumption of juice has decreased by roughly one gallon. The same goes for orange juice specifically: total domestic consumption of orange juice in the United States dropped from over 810 metric tons in 2010/11 to roughly 486 metric tons in 2023/24.

In 2024, the global orange juice (single strength) market increased by 18% to $3.3B, rising for the fourth consecutive year after two years of decline. Over the period under review, the total consumption indicated a noticeable expansion from 2012 to 2024: its value increased at an average annual rate of +4.4% over the last twelve-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period.

The organic orange juice market is segmented by product type into Not-From-Concentrate (NFC) and From Concentrate (FC). Not-From-Concentrate (NFC) juice is perceived as higher in quality and nutritional value, which makes it a preferred choice among health-conscious consumers. The demand for NFC organic orange juice is driven by its fresh taste, higher vitamin content, and minimal processing. This segment is expected to witness substantial growth as more consumers become aware of its benefits compared to concentrate juice.
From Concentrate (FC) organic orange juice, on the other hand, has a longer shelf life and is more convenient for packaging, storage, and transportation. This makes it a popular choice among manufacturers and retailers. While the nutritional profile of FC juice is often debated, advancements in processing technologies are helping to retain the essential nutrients, making it a viable option for many consumers.
